20160124107 | APPARATUS AND METHODS FOR MAKING AZIMUTHAL RESISTIVITY MEASUREMENTS - A resistivity measuring tool used in a drillstring having a drill bit on a distal end for drilling a wellbore in a formation includes a tool body having a longitudinal axis, a sensor configured to measure the angular position of the tool body relative to the wellbore, at least one axial antenna including a wire winding for generating an axial magnetic moment parallel with the longitudinal axis, and at least one transverse antenna. The transverse antenna includes an antenna body disposed within a pocket extending radially inward from an outer surface of the tool body and one or more turns of wire wound around the antenna body, the wire winding generating a transverse magnetic moment orthogonal to the longitudinal axis. | 05-05-2016 |
20150362615 | APPARATUS AND METHODS FOR COMMUNICATING WITH A DOWNHOLE TOOL - An apparatus for communicating with a downhole tool includes a sensor body including at least two electrodes electrically insulated from one another and an external control device configured to engage the two electrodes. Detection circuitry connected to the two electrodes is configured to monitor an electrical status across the two electrodes, through the external control device, and upon detecting a change in electrical status that matches a predefined pattern, communicate a command to power management circuitry to alter a power status of the downhole tool. | 12-17-2015 |
20150293254 | APPARATUS AND METHOD FOR DOWNHOLE RESISTIVITY MEASUREMENTS - A downhole tool includes a body having a longitudinal axis and bore therethrough, an array of longitudinal electrode segments separated by electrical insulators, wherein substantially an entire cross section of said body comprises at least one electrode segment, at least one longitudinal electrode configured to emit a first electrical current into said formation and measure said first emitted current, at least one longitudinal electrode segment configured to emit a second electrical current for directing said first emitted current into said formation, and at least one longitudinal electrode segment configured to receive said first emitted current returning from said formation. | 10-15-2015 |
20150107900 | SYSTEM AND METHODS FOR SELECTIVE SHORTING OF AN ELECTRICAL INSULATOR SECTION - A bottom hole assembly attached to a drillstring includes a main body including multiple electrical insulator sections along a length thereof, each of the electrical insulator sections configured to have a voltage difference generated there across, wherein a transmitting electrical insulator section having a voltage difference generated there across is configured to remain open, and wherein all remaining electrical insulator sections are configured to be electrically shorted there across. | 04-23-2015 |
